The newest LG Mobile Phones: Xenon, Neon, Invision, Incite, and CF360

Friday 24 April 2009 @ 11:00 am

The LG Xenon features a 2.8-inch touchscreen display with enhanced flash UI and vibration feedback. Thus, all shortcuts and menus are available at your fingertips. Moreover, the full-touch home screen of the LG Xenon can be customized to meet the requirements of the user. The mobile phone has also got a slide-out QWERTY keyboard and dedicated keys for email and text messages.
As for messaging and communication, The LG Xenon has integrated threaded conversation technology and support wireless communication with Bluetooth technology. This mobile phone is multi-task oriented, i.e. you can quickly switch between calls and other functions. For instance, you don’t have to turn off the music player when there is an incoming call – it will be turned off automatically and resumed when the talk is over. So, this is how the new LG Xenon works.

Exceptional Features of the BlackBerry Storm Smartphone

Friday 24 April 2009 @ 11:00 am

The first thing to be mentioned is the unique SurePress™ touch-screen that allows precise and easy typing and responds like a physical keyboard. The touch-screen interface supports gestures, single-touch and multi-touch, all making navigation efficient and intuitive.
SurePress™ was distinguished with the GSMA’s Best Mobile Technology Breakthrough award at the latest MWC.

Bring your beat to the street with the new Sony Ericsson W205 Walkman™

Wednesday 8 April 2009 @ 11:00 am

Get the most out of your best music and favourite radio channels with Walkman™ player, FM radio and TrackID™ music recognition. The slider mobile phone comes with a complete package of entertainment features and the power to set up playlists to ensure you have the right music no matter the occasion. Share your tunes with friends via the speaker phone function – if you love your music they will too.
Need a change? Tune into the FM radio to listen to the latest news, music, sport commentary and talk shows. Heard something you like? Use TrackID™ to name that tune and artist, and you can even record a sample of a song from the radio to use as your new ringtone.
“The W205 is perfect for those who love portable music but have never had the Walkman™ phone experience.” said Timo Maassmann, Marketing business manager at Sony Ericsson. “The W205 is a stylish slider phone allowing you to enjoy your music wherever you are – whether it’s on the bus, at college or chilling in the park. You can also share more than music with the 1.3 megapixel camera. Capture the action in stills or video and send them to friends via MMS or via Bluetooth™. The multiple phonebook function is an added bonus – share your phone with your family but keep your contacts separate from theirs.”
Fill it with pop and make it rock with the following features:
• Enjoy your music with the Walkman™ experience
• FM radio – catch up with the latest news and views
• TrackID™ – name that tune at a press of a button
• 1.3 megapixel camera – capture your favourite moments on film
• Bluetooth™ – share your favourite songs, pictures and video clips, or connect to a wireless headset
• Multiple phone books – keep your contacts in order if someone needs to borrow your phone
The W205 Walkman™ supports GSM/GPRS/900/1800 and W205a supports GSM/GPRS 850/1900. W205 Walkman™ will be available in selected markets from Q3 in the colour Ambient Black. The MS410 Snap-on Speaker Stand will be available in selected markets from Q2 2009.

Capture daily moments the easy way with the Sony Ericsson S312

Wednesday 8 April 2009 @ 11:00 am

Record videos in an instant on the Sony Ericsson S312. From spotting a celebrity on the street, to your friend’s dancing in a club, the S312 allows you to capture these moments in two quick and easy steps.
Want to highlight the moment with a picture instead? The two megapixel camera can be used horizontally and with the help of the illuminated imaging shortcuts on the keypad you can change the settings and get the shot you want quicker. Not quite what you were after? Use the integrated Photo fix function to get the best picture quality in one step – picture taking has never been this easy!
Sharing your pictures with friends is easier than ever before. Showcase them on the S312’s two inch screen or forward to another mobile phone via Bluetooth™. Share your pictures on the web with just a few clicks using picture blogging. Whatever the occasion post photos straight from the phone with just a few clicks – and don’t forget to send the web address to others to check out your photography skills.
Take the hassle out of capturing daily moments:
• Dedicated video camera key – just one click away from recording your best moments
• Two megapixel camera – can be used horizontally to take picture perfect stills
• Illuminated imaging shortcuts – take great shots with ease
• Photo fix – enhance the picture quality and share with family and friends
• Picture blogging – upload your images to the web with just a few clicks
• Get organised – calendar, alarm and 1000 contact phone book
The S312 supports GSM/GPRS/EDGE/900/1800 and will be available in selected markets from Q2 in the colours Dawn Blue and Honey Silver. The Clip-on Bluetooth™ Handsfree VH300 will be available on selected markets from Q3 2009.
